The Early Years: Foundations of Excellence

To understand who influenced Devin Booker, we must first delve into his early years. Born on October 30, 1996, in Grand Rapids, Michigan, Booker was raised in a family that valued sports. His father, Melvin Booker, was a professional basketball player. He played in the NBA and overseas, which undoubtedly shaped Devins early perception of the sport. Growing up, Devin was surrounded by basketball. The sport was not just a hobby; it was a way of life. Melvins influence was profound, as he guided Devins initial steps on the court, teaching him the fundamentals that would become second nature as he matured.

The Local Influence: High School Basketball

Devin attended the University of Kentucky, but before that, he made a name for himself at Moss Point High School in Mississippi. His high school coach, Eric D. Smith, played a significant role in his basketball development. Smith recognized Devins potential early on and pushed him to elevate his game. Under his guidance, Devin learned the importance of teamwork, leadership, and the competitive spirit necessary to succeed at a higher level.

Coaches often serve as pivotal figures in the lives of young athletes. For Devin, Coach Smith was more than just a coach; he was a mentor who instilled foundational values while also challenging Devin to push his boundaries. The experience at Moss Point High School also allowed him to compete against other talented players, helping him understand the importance of not just individual skill but also basketball IQ and strategic thinking.

The College Experience: Mentorship and Growth

Transitioning to college, Devin enrolled at the University of Kentucky, where he would face new challenges and opportunities. Here, he was coached by John Calipari, a well-known figure in college basketball. Calipari has a reputation for developing young talent and preparing them for the NBA. Under his guidance, Devin learned about work ethic, discipline, and the importance of playing at a high level consistently.

Calipari’s coaching style emphasizes player development, which was instrumental in Devin’s growth as a player. He learned to refine his skills, adapt to varying gameplay styles, and become a more strategic player. The mentorship from Calipari provided him with a strong foundation that would prove invaluable as he transitioned to the professional league.

While at Kentucky, Devin was also surrounded by a talented roster of teammates who influenced his game. Players like Karl-Anthony Towns and Willie Cauley-Stein were not only peers but also sources of inspiration. Competing against such talent pushed Devin to continuously improve and assess his gameplay critically. The camaraderie and competition fostered at Kentucky helped to shape his skills and laid the groundwork for his future success in the NBA.

The NBA Journey: Learning from the Best

Upon entering the NBA as the 13th overall pick in the 2015 draft, Devin joined the Phoenix Suns. His entry into the league exposed him to some of the best players in the game. Competing against veterans like Eric Bledsoe and Brandon Knight offered him insights into different playing styles and strategies. Learning from seasoned players helped him adapt more quickly to the professional level.

As his career progressed, Devin had the opportunity to play alongside and compete against some of the games greats, including LeBron James and Stephen Curry. These experiences have had a lasting impact on his development as a player. Observing their work ethic, understanding their mental approach to the game, and learning from their experiences provided invaluable lessons that he has incorporated into his own approach.

Moreover, Devin has often expressed admiration for players like Kobe Bryant, who had a profound influence on many in the basketball community. Bryants relentless pursuit of excellence and his Mamba Mentality resonated deeply with Devin. The lessons he learned from Bryants career—about hard work, dedication, and the pursuit of greatness—have become a part of Devins philosophy as he strives to be the best player he can be.
